PULSETRAIN GmbH (originally founded as Bavertis) is a technology company that develops electric powertrains. The company combines traditional powertrain systems with a pulsing technology for batteries. PULSETRAIN has offices in Munich, Germany, and Graz, Austria. History. PULSETRAIN, originally founded as Bavertis in 2022, was conceptualized through the doctoral thesis of Dr. Manuel Kuder and further developed with Niclas Lehnert, focusing on sustainable long living and efficient energy solutions. The company, headquartered in Munich, Bavaria, Germany, initially concentrated on making battery systems smarter, more modular, and more durable. PULSETRAIN GmbH continues with the technological approach and focuses on improving service life for battery storage systems in mobility applications. The company has received several awards for its technology. In 2022, the company was on the 1st Place in the I.E.C.T Challenge X Alpine Tech, the GreenTech Venture Award, and the VDE Bayern Award. The company also won the Münchner Businessplan Wettbewerb and Gründerszene Pitch-Battle in 2023, and was listed in the European Startup Prize TOP 50. In November 2024, PULSETRAIN won the Süddeutsche Zeitung Gipfelstürmer Award in the Mobility category for its system that extends battery lifespan. In March 2025, PULSETRAIN GmbH raised €6.1M in seed financing to transform EV battery performance and efficiency. The funding round, led by Vsquared Ventures and Planet A, with support from Climate Club, will be used to advance product development and prepare for scaling and industrialization. PULSETRAIN GmbH creates AI-driven and fully integrated battery management systems. Technology and products. The company provides a fully integrated powertrain technology that combines an onboard charger, inverter, and battery management system with AI software. This technology aims to energy management and performance in electric vehicles. PULSETRAIN’s technology integrates the Battery Management System (BMS), inverter, and charging electronics into a single "In-Battery" technology, incorporating a multilevel inverter and AI to enhance energy efficiency and extend electric vehicle battery lifespan by up to 80%.
